Flint Public Library
The Flint Public Library serves the City of Flint and Genesee County through a Main Library, three branch libraries and a Bookmobile. The Main Library, offers an extensive reference department, research collections, local history and genealogy collections and 50,000 volume Children's Library. The Library serves as an important community gathering place which allows the library to host lectures, concerts, author visits, and other community events. The three branch libraries provide library and information services to neighborhoods in West Flint, North Flint and South Flint. The Bookmobile brings library services to day care centers and neighborhood centers. Check out the "Kids Web" site as well.

Ready, Set, Grow! Passport
A parenting information, education and referral program for Genesee County families with children infancy through age six. Families can earn "kid cash" vouchers by completing activities promoting the health & well-being of their child. "Kid Cash" vouchers can be redeemed at various local businesses for service. Comfort Calls are also available for families needing telephone support.
